Scott Walker Posed in Lingerie on a Nazi Flag?

Rumor: Photograph shows a young Wisconsin governor Scott Walker posing in lingerie on a Nazi flag.

Claim:   Photograph shows a young Wisconsin governor Scott Walker posing in women's lingerie on a Nazi flag.


PROBABLY FALSE

Origins:  In April 2015, a photograph purportedly showing Scott Walker posing in women's lingerie atop a Nazi rug began circulating via social media along with the claim that the picture had been snapped during the Wisconsin governor's college days at Marquette University.

While the exact origins of the above-displayed photograph are unknown, there are several aspects of this rumor that ring false.

First of all, this image did not "mysteriously surface": It has been on the web since at least 2008 when it was posted to several Russian-language internet forums along with messages equating homosexuality with fascism. The photograph has also been used in "Demotivational Posters" and in a meme mocking grammar Nazis. It wasn't until April 2015 that Scott Walker's name became attached to the photograph.

It should also be noted that the image originated on Russian websites. While it is not impossible for a college photo of Scott Walker to make its way overseas before hitting the American web, that circumstance is highly unlikely.

Furthermore, there is no evidence that the man pictured in the photo is Scott Walker other than his bearing a passing resemblance to the Wisconsin Governor:

The claim that Scott Walker was "kicked out of school," as the viral image alleges, is also untrue. Walker attended Marquette University from the Fall of 1986 until the Spring of 1990. While it is true that he never graduated, the school released a statement in 2013 saying that Walker was in good standing when he voluntarily left the university:


Gov. Scott Walker was a student at Marquette from fall of 1986 until spring 1990 and was a senior in good standing when he voluntarily withdrew from Marquette.

Governor Walker was in good standing each term while he was enrolled at Marquette University and when he left Marquette University. Governor Walker was not expelled or suspended from the university at any time.


 

Although this photo does show a man posing in lingerie on a Nazi rug, that man is likely not Scott Walker.
